GX06 HVO is a 2006 Peugeot Ludix in Orange with a 49c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 86.7%.
Across all 2006 Peugeot Ludix models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.2% with a typical mileage of 14,092 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Peugeot Ludix fails its MOT is brake lever has inadequate reserve travel, accounting for 394 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GX06 HVO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Peugeot Ludix typ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 20 years old, this Peugeot Ludix is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
